Output 33ed95df96ec203ab9c12f863681778e1b5aa499031b163da7daa48796106522:67

value
145895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 318d43a66d3e04aba02e178d6b90718ed60d28ca OP_EQUAL
address
36D2GA1dp4v9Q1H1h1JuEvzX1s1MCdktBs
transaction
33ed95df96ec203ab9c12f863681778e1b5aa499031b163da7daa48796106522
spent
true